The global TimoFlight (TOF) sensor market is expected to grow at a CAGR of around 16.5% during the forecast period, from 2021 to 2030. The growth of this market can be attributed to the increasing demand for AR and VR technology in various industries such as automotive, industrial, healthcare, smart advertising, gaming and entertainment. The AR technology is expected to dominate the global TimoFlight (TOF) sensor market during the forecast period due to its wide range of applications in various industries such as automotive and industrial.

  1. The TOF sensor market is expected to grow at a CAGR of over 10% during the forecast period.
  2. The increasing demand for 3D imaging and gesture recognition technologies in smartphones is driving the growth of the TOF sensor market.
  3. The increasing use of TOF sensors in automotive applications such as collision avoidance systems, lane departure warning systems, and adaptive cruise control is also driving the growth of this market.
  4. Increasing adoption of 3D sensing technology in virtual reality headsets will drive the growth of this market.
  5. Increasing demand for gesture recognition technology in smart home devices will drive the growth of this market.
